Bank of America, founded in 1904 as the Bank of Italy by Amadeo Giannini to serve immigrants in San Francisco, is now one of the largest financial institutions in the world, head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, following its 1998 merger with NationsBank. It provides a broad spectrum of services, including consumer banking, wealth management (through its Merrill division), commercial banking, and investment ban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ers globally.

Bank of America's Q2 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2024, Bank of America held 8,606 positions worth $1.13T, up 2.8% from $1.1T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

Bank of America's Q2 2024 filing shows 856 new, 3,718 increased, 2,898 reduced and 411 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Ferrovial N.V. Ordinary Shares: 12,913,805 shares worth $497M. The largest sale was iShares Core S&P 500 ETF, an estimated $4.01B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 15% of assets, up from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
